A PUTIN mercenary who kept a “skull of a dead Ukrainian soldier” as a prize has been gunned down in a targeted attack.

Igor Mangushev was shot in the head and rushed to a hospital in Donetsk, Ukraine, where he is reportedly in a “grave” condition.

The hit on the sick Russian propagandist happened in the early hours of Saturday, January 4.

Analysts claim the assassination attempt may be a warning to the leader of Russia’s mercenary Wagner group, Yevgeny Prigozhin.

Mangushev, 36, was one of Russia’s most notable TV spin doctors before he enlisted in Putin’s army using the call name, Bereg.

Shocking pictures on social media showed Mangushev lying bloodied on a hospital bed connected to life support equipment.

His friend Boris Rozhkin shared the image, who described his condition as “grave”.

According to The Daily Telegraph, doctors concluded he was shot from a handgun at close range.

No further details of the attack have been confirmed.

However, Russia expert Mark Galeotti believed Mangushev had significant ties to the Wagner group and that it could have been a proxy attack.

Galeotti said: “I think we can safely describe this as a hit.

“This could be a warning or taking a pawn off the board.

“Or it is a sign that Mr Prigozhin’s more thuggish rivals feel he is weakened enough that they can move.”

In August 2022, Mangushev disgraced himself publicly brandishing the skull of a “dead Ukrainian fighter” during a stage show.

The skull supposedly belonged to a slain fighter killed near the Azovstal steel plant in Ukraine. 

During a speech, deranged Mangushev held up the skull and said: “We’re alive and this guy is already dead.

“Let him burn in hell. He wasn’t lucky. We’ll make a goblet out of his skull.”

He ranted: “Why can’t there be any reconciliation? 

“Ukraine must be de-Ukrainised. The Russian lands of Novorossiya must be returned back. 

“We are not at war with people of blood and flesh. We are at war with an idea — Ukraine as an anti-Russian state.

“This is the tragedy of Ukrainian soldiers. We don’t care how many we have to kill.

“If we were at war with people we could make peace with them.”

Mangushev is supposedly fighting against Ukraine but he is also the head of nationalist movement Light Russia and a creator of a private army ENOT, which is said to have links to the FSB.

The chilling performance with the human skull violates the Criminal Code of the Russian Federation and is a war crime in international law.

On his Telegram channel, the twisted Russian has also openly called for the killing of civilians.

His post read: “We will burn your houses, kill your families, take away your children and raise them Russians.”
